The PGA Tour announced the nominees for its prestigious Player of the Year award, the Jack Nicklaus Award, and two of golf’s most prominent figures, Scottie Scheffler and Rory McIlroy, are among the top contenders for the honor. This year’s list of nominees reflects an extraordinary season filled with remarkable performances, with each of the golfers nominated having made an indelible impact on the tour over the course of 2025.
Scottie Scheffler’s candidacy for the Player of the Year award is the result of a dominant season, one that saw him claim six titles, including two major championships—the PGA Championship and The Open. Scheffler’s stellar performance throughout the year was marked by consistency and excellence, finishing in the top-10 17 times and, impressively, not missing a single cut all season. Rory McIlroy, who has long been considered one of the game’s best, also finds himself among the nominees following a stellar 2025 campaign. McIlroy’s victory at the Masters, which completed his career Grand Slam, was one of the defining moments of his career, cementing his legacy as one of golf’s greatest players. The triumph at Augusta was particularly sweet for McIlroy, who had long sought to capture the Masters title to join the exclusive group of golfers who have won all four majors. Beyond the Masters, McIlroy added three other titles to his 2025 resume, further proving that despite his previous major victories, he remains at the top of his game. Alongside Scheffler and McIlroy, the list of nominees includes Tommy Fleetwood, who claimed the 2025 FedExCup championship, and Ben Griffin, a rising star who secured three tour victories in the same year. Fleetwood’s first FedExCup title, a culmination of a year of steady and impressive performances, was one of the most remarkable achievements of his career, showing that he is more than capable of competing with the best in the game. Meanwhile, Griffin’s three victories in 2025—each of them an impressive feat—further solidified his place as one of the top young talents on the PGA Tour. The Jack Nicklaus Award is one of the most prestigious honors in professional golf, and it is awarded based on a vote from PGA Tour members. The winner of the 2025 Player of the Year will be determined after the ballots close on December 12, and the anticipation surrounding the announcement is high.
